Express deep emotion with LOVE & PASSION, a luxurious hand-tied bouquet from Harold Hill Florist. Designed to capture the intensity and grace of true romance, this arrangement features rich velvet red roses paired with elegant purple-shade roses, beautifully accented by red hypericum berries for added depth and texture. Perfect for anniversaries, Valentine's Day, or any moment you want to make unforgettable, this premium bouquet delivers a striking contrast of colour and sophistication.

Each LOVE & PASSION bouquet is carefully crafted by our expert florists in Harold Hill and delivered in bud to ensure maximum freshness and longevity. Watch your roses gradually open and reveal their full beauty over several days, backed by our 5-day freshness guarantee. The deluxe size bouquet pictured showcases the full, lavish effect of this romantic design.

Whether you're sending flowers to a loved one in Harold Hill or nearby areas, you can rely on our friendly, reliable service and swift next-day flower delivery for orders placed before 4 pm. As some blooms are seasonal, we may substitute flowers with similar colours and styles of equal or higher value, ensuring your bouquet always looks stunning.
